We use 18mm exterior-grade plywood for most residential windows here—tough enough for BN26’s variable weather but light for easy installation. For doors, anti-tamper fixings are standard; they screw from inside only, preventing removal from the road. If a frame’s too damaged, we’ll assess on-site and discuss options like temporary steel doors before cutting into structure.

What Happens After We Board Up
You get:
- Clear documentation: Photos (with timestamps), work description, and materials list—insurers in the BN area know what to expect.
- Invoice breakdown: No surprises; labour, materials, and any call-out noted separately.
- Advice on next steps: Keep your crime reference (if burglary), snap pre-arrival photos if safe, and contact your insurer early. We’re not adjusters, but our reports match what they need for insurance claims.
For vacant properties common around here—perhaps between lets near the recreation ground—we recommend steel security screens for longer-term protection. They allow ventilation while deterring squatters.
